Marriage Licenses

One of the most well-known services provided by the Clark County Clerk is the issuance of marriage licenses. Las Vegas, often called the “Wedding Capital of the World,” sees countless couples come to tie the knot, making this service extremely busy. If you're looking to get married, you will need to apply for a marriage license in person at the Clark County Marriage License Bureau. Both partners must be present to apply. You'll need to provide valid photo identification, such as a driver's license, passport, or state-issued ID. There is a fee associated with the license, so be prepared to pay that at the time of application. The application process itself is straightforward; you'll fill out a form providing basic information. After the license is issued, there is a waiting period before the ceremony can take place. Once the ceremony is complete, the officiant is responsible for returning the signed license to the Clerk's office, officially recording your marriage. It's really that simple! Keep in mind that specific rules, like age requirements and any pre-existing marriage restrictions, will be confirmed before a license is issued. Business Licenses and Filings

Besides marriages, the Clark County Clerk’s office is also a key player in business registrations and filings. If you’re an aspiring entrepreneur dreaming of starting a business in Clark County, you will likely need to interact with the Clark County Clerk. The Clerk’s office processes various business licenses, ensuring that your venture is legally permitted to operate within the county. The specific requirements can vary depending on the type of business you're planning to launch. It’s crucial to understand the licensing regulations applicable to your industry. You’ll also need to consider registering your business name, ensuring it complies with state laws and isn't already in use. When you go through the registration process, you’ll typically need to provide basic information about your business, including its structure (sole proprietorship, partnership, LLC, etc.), the nature of your business, and contact details. In some instances, depending on the type of business, you might also need to obtain additional permits or licenses from other county or state agencies.
